Output fb78a2ad00a44f8622a94faebffaebeb69f19682ccfd63b0920627ec01b7603a:3

value
3077959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d023e29c0a5e297ccbd7af1db18e4c24f9a3e58 OP_EQUAL
address
3EYbtRfQmR6EopnGrpndkQbM4tqbFXnBGV
transaction
fb78a2ad00a44f8622a94faebffaebeb69f19682ccfd63b0920627ec01b7603a
confirmations
304775
spent
true